Defecating dreams can have various psychological interpretations depending on the context in which they occur. Here are some common explanations:

  1. Anxiety and Stress Relief: One possible interpretation is that these dreams represent an individual’s need to release tension or stress from their daily life. The act of defecation symbolizes letting go of negative emotions, much like how we physically expel waste from our bodies.

  2. Unresolved Issues: If you have recently encountered a challenging situation at work or in your personal life, a dream involving defecation may signify that there are unresolved issues still lingering within your subconscious mind. This type of dream could be your brain’s way of trying to process and resolve these uncertainties.

  3. Fear of Judgment: In some cases, a defecating dream might reflect an underlying fear of judgment or embarrassment. The act of defecation in public often carries social stigmas, making it a source of shame for many people. These dreams could be symbolic representations of our desire to avoid being judged by others.

  4. Insecurity and Self-Esteem: Another psychological interpretation is that these dreams stem from feelings of insecurity or low self-esteem. Just as physical waste needs to be eliminated from the body, so too must we discard any negative thoughts or beliefs about ourselves.

If you’ve had a dream involving defecation, here are some steps you can take to understand its meaning:

  1. Reflect on Your Emotions: Consider how you felt during the dream and what emotions were associated with it. Were you anxious, embarrassed, or stressed? Understanding these feelings can provide insight into the underlying message behind your dream.

  2. Examine Your Daily Life: Take a moment to reflect on any recent challenges or events that may have triggered anxiety or stress in your waking life. These experiences could be contributing factors to your defecating dreams.

  3. Keep a Dream Journal: Writing down your dreams can help you better understand their meaning and symbolism. Over time, patterns may emerge, offering valuable insights into your subconscious thoughts and emotions.

  4. Seek Professional Help: If you continue experiencing recurring defecating dreams, it might be beneficial to consult with a mental health professional who can provide guidance and support in interpreting these dreams.
